  • Sheffield: Sheffield is a vibrant city located 5.6km from Grindleford, renowned for its stunning outdoor landscapes and rich industrial heritage. Visitors can explore the picturesque Peak District National Park that surrounds the city, offering ample opportunities for hiking, cycling, and rock climbing. The city itself boasts a variety of attractions, including the iconic Sheffield Arena for live events and a wealth of shopping options in its bustling centres. With its unique blend of green spaces and urban facilities, Sheffield is an excellent destination for adventure seekers and city explorers alike.
  • Buxton: Buxton, situated 7.5km from Grindleford, is a charming spa town famed for its natural thermal springs and beautiful Georgian architecture. The town offers a plethora of outdoor activities, from leisurely strolls in the pavilion gardens to adventurous hikes in the surrounding countryside. Buxton is also home to the Buxton Opera House, where visitors can enjoy a variety of performances in a stunning historic setting. With its scenic surroundings and cultural offerings, Buxton is a delightful spot for those looking to relax and indulge in the arts.
  • Bakewell: Just 3.7km from Grindleford, Bakewell is a quaint market town known for its picturesque scenery and delightful charm. The area is perfect for outdoor enthusiasts, with numerous hiking trails that weave through the stunning countryside. Bakewell is also famous for its Bakewell pudding, making it a must-visit for food lovers. Visitors can enjoy recreational areas, golf courses, and the historic charm of the town centre, which features quaint shops and cafes. With its rich heritage and scenic beauty, Bakewell offers a relaxing retreat in the heart of the Peak District.

How to get to and around Grindleford

The nearest airport is in Manchester Airport (MAN), located 26.6 mi (42.9 km) from the city centre. If you can't find a flight that works for your travel itinerary, you could also fly into Doncaster (DSA-Sheffield), which is 29.1 mi (46.8 km) away.

If you're travelling by train, the main station serving the city is Grindleford Station.

What are the top attractions in Grindleford?
In Grindleford, visitors can engage in the stunning natural beauty of the Peak District National Park, which offers a wealth of outdoor activities such as hiking and rock climbing. The picturesque Padley Gorge is a short walk away, providing a tranquil setting with its flowing streams and ancient woodlands, superb for leisurely strolls and picnics.

The village itself features charming stone cottages and a couple of local pubs that serve traditional fare, making it a delightful spot to experience local hospitality. Additionally, the nearby Longshaw Estate offers expansive grounds and scenic views, ideal for nature enthusiasts. For those interested in history, the historic St. Helen's Church stands as a top landmark within the village.
